What are Regional Cost Breakdowns?
Regional cost breakdowns refer to the detailed analysis of various costs associated with a specific geographical location. These costs can range from operational expenses, transportation, labor, and raw materials to local taxes and various regulatory fees. A thorough understanding of these cost components enables businesses to make strategic decisions regarding production, supply chain management, and market entry strategies.
Key Components of Regional Cost Breakdowns
1. Labor Costs
- Wages and salaries
- Benefits and insurance
- Recruitment and training expenses
2. Operational Costs
- Rent and utilities
- Equipment depreciation
- Maintenance and repair expenses
3. Material Costs
- Sourcing and procurement
- Local vs. imported materials
- Storage and logistics
4. Transportation Costs
- Shipping and delivery expenses
- Fuel costs
- Customs duties (if applicable)
5. Taxation
- Local and state taxes
- Incentives or subsidies for businesses
- License fees and regulatory costs
Understanding these components allows businesses to assess the feasibility of operations in various regions, helping them optimize resources and streamline expenses.

Methodologies for Analyzing Regional Cost Breakdowns
There are various methodologies that businesses can employ to analyze regional costs effectively:
1. Comparative Analysis
- Compare costs across different regions for similar operations.
- Identify the most cost-effective locations.
2. Time Series Analysis
- Assess how regional costs have changed over time.
- Investigate trends that could impact future operations or pricing strategies.
3. Variance Analysis
- Evaluate differences between estimated and actual costs in various regions.
- Identify areas for improvement or reassessment.
4. Scenario Planning
- Create best, worst, and most likely case scenarios based on cost evaluations.
- Use this data to plan strategically for uncertainties in different markets.
Challenges in Regional Cost Breakdown Analyses
While regional cost breakdowns provide valuable insights, several challenges may arise:
- Data Availability: Accurate data on regional costs may not always be available or may be outdated.
- Complexity: Different regions may have varying factors affecting costs, making it challenging to compare them clearly.
- Market volatility: Sudden shifts in economic conditions, such as inflation or policy changes, can rapidly alter cost structures.
